Transaction 8feda20de4948309bd7422fa70e5799113467992ef115fcdb765211ac0d15fc9
1 Input
1 Output
-
8feda20de4948309bd7422fa70e5799113467992ef115fcdb765211ac0d15fc9:0
- value
- 14475167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72bbde8f33343f6e18fc362d940be2eaf157d5ce OP_EQUAL
- address
- 3C9g1ofBBYjCrErp2425fh5hknqvNqaT1L